Pursuant to Act 9 of 2020 that Governor Wolf signed into law on 3/27/2020, contributory employers and reimbursable employers who have an approved 2020 solvency fee election were to receive automatic relief from charges for those employees whose UC claims are due to the COVID-19 outbreak or public health officials’ efforts to contain and prevent the spread of COVID-19. Contributory employers and reimbursable employers who have paid the solvency fee for calendar year 2020 did not have to apply for relief from these COVID-19 related charges.
The benefit charge credits/adjustments from the automatic relief from charges for eligible claims for Article XI reimbursable employers that have an approved 2020 solvency fee election were included on the Statement of Account dated 11/11/2020. For Article X and Article XII reimbursable employers with an approved 2020 solvency fee election, the benefit charge credits/adjustments will be processed in the beginning of January 2021 and appear on the Statement of Account dated 1/11/2021.
The benefit charge credits/adjustments for contributory employers have been processed and their reserve account ledger updated accordingly. To view your reserve account ledger, login to your account, or register for a user ID to login to your account, at www.uctax.pa.gov. After logging in select the Financial Activities option from the menu on the left and then the Ledgers sub-menu option. Select the Reserve Account tab to view the summary of your reserve account ledger and your current reserve account balance.
